#07e013 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#07e013 is composed of 2.7% red, 87.8%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 91.5%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 123.3 degrees, a saturation of 93.9% and a lightness of 45.3%. #07e013 color hex could be obtained by blending #0eff26 with #00c100. Closest websafe color is: #00cc00.

Shades and Tints of #07e013

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000f01 is the darkest color, while #fbfffb is the lightest one.
